About Alex Bucklee:
Alex is a London-based designer and artist. Originally from Norfolk, Alex moved to East London as a young adult, where he worked as a designer for multiple global brands before embarking on a career as a professional artist. His work blends minimalist and striking graphics drawn from his design background and often uses typography to convey his message. His immaculate screen prints are hand-finished with tools of the Street Art trade such as spray paints and Krink graffiti markers. Bucklee’s art explores contemporary social and personal themes such as loneliness, homophobia, and political apathy. His humorous and graceful work aims to help address societal issues and personal struggles by sparking discussion.

Alex Bucklee is a printmaking artist living in London who produces screen prints with a message. He could easily be considered a subversive artist. Alex is a relatively new artist who draws heavily from traditional graphic design and illustration techniques, combining images and typography in thought-provoking ways.
